Nettet33 rader · INS Yaffo (K-42) Jaffa: Formerly HMS Zodiac (R54). Purchased from UK in … NettetINS Kidon, INS Tarshish, and INS Yaffo commissioned in 1994, 1995, and 1998 respectively. Particularly INS Kidon and INS Yaffo were built comprising various older systems that were disassembled from Sa'ar 4-class missile boats with the same names, atop brand new Sa'ar 4.5-class hulls.
